Lancaster Conservancy offering public hunting
archery_bulls.gif
At a time when land in and around Lancaster County is being gobbled up for development, and is increasingly being posted by private landowners to prohibit general hunting, the nonprofit Conservancy has 4,320 acres within the county open to public hunting.
And it’s always looking to acquire more land.
That acreage is in addition to the 14,725 acres the Pennsylvania Game Commission has available for public hunting in and adjacent to Lancaster County across six sections of State Game Lands.
But the Game Commission buys and maintains State Game Lands specifically for public hunting, using hunting license dollars and other money related to hunting in Pennsylvania.
The Conservancy buys land “to save important natural places for people and wildlife” using donations of money or land from preservation-minded citizens and organizations, according to its website.
